Deviled Eggs. — Cook eggs until hard boiled. Pour cold water over to cool rapidly and prevent discoloring. Remove the shells and cut in halves crosswise. Remove the yolks and mash them with a fork. For four eggs mix one fourth teaspoon of mustard, one fourth teaspoon of salt, one eighth teaspoon of pepper, with two teaspoons of melted butterDeviled Eggs. Add the yolks, and mix well. Fill the ‘whites with the mixture. Bacon and Fried EggsBacon and Fried Eggs. — Cook bacon until crisp, remove from the frying pan, and turn the eggs one at a time into the hot fat. When the whites are firm and the yolks coated with a film, remove the eggs carefully, and serve at once. Eggs are sometimes turned and fried on both sides, but they should not be fried brown, because that indicates that they are cooked at too high a temperature. Eggs are frequently fried with ham in the same manner as with bacon. It is a perfect food for the young calf, because it contains all the elements needed for its nourishment up toa certain stage of its growth. The milk of all animals differs slightly in composition, so the milk of one mammal is not a perfect food for others. Cow’s milk must have the pro- tein diluted, and sugar added, to make it a perfect food for the human infant. Milk is not a perfect food for an adult because it contains too much water, not enough carbohydrate in proportion to its protein, and no cellulose or waste matter. It must be eaten with bulky foods. ? The most important constituent in milk is protein. The protein is in the form of albumin, casein, and compound proteins. Heat coagulates the albumin, and it comes to the top of boiled milk in the form of a thin skin. The casein is not coagulated by heat, but by the ferment rennin, and it is precipitated by the presence of lactic acid during the sour- ing of milk. The fat occurs in minute globules. When milk stands for a time, these globules rise to the surface and form cream.
